3. Add Life with Indoor Plants

Indoor plants breathe life into any home, quite literally. Whether it’s a tall fiddle-leaf fig in the corner or small succulents on the coffee table, greenery adds freshness and vitality to the space. Additionally, plants like peace lilies and snake plants help purify the air. For those with less time to care for plants, low-maintenance options like pothos or cacti are ideal. Their natural beauty pairs well with any decor style and adds a calming touch to the home.

9. Brighten Up with Mirrors

Mirrors are a fantastic way to enhance natural light and make a space feel larger. Placing a mirror opposite a window reflects sunlight, brightening the room. They also serve as stylish decor pieces, available in various shapes, sizes, and frames. From ornate vintage designs to sleek modern options, mirrors blend seamlessly with any interior theme. Additionally, they’re practical for daily use, adding both functionality and elegance to entryways, bedrooms, or bathrooms.

18. Enhance the Space with Curtains

Curtains not only provide privacy but also elevate the room’s aesthetic. Choose fabrics and patterns that complement the overall decor, whether it’s sheer curtains for a light, airy look or heavy drapes for a dramatic effect. Additionally, layering curtains with blinds or shades adds depth and functionality. Properly hung curtains can also make ceilings appear higher, enhancing the sense of space. They are a simple yet effective way to add warmth and sophistication.
